MercadoLibre (MELI) recently released its first quarter 2026 financial results, demonstrating continued momentum in the Latin American digital commerce landscape. The e-commerce platform reported revenue of $28.89 billion, reflecting robust growth driven by increased transaction volume and expanding service offerings across its key markets. Management Commentary
The leadership team addressed the company's strategic priorities during the earnings discussion. Management highlighted investments in logistics infrastructure as a key driver of competitive advantage, enabling faster delivery times and improved customer experience across the region.
MercadoLibre's executives emphasized their commitment to expanding financial inclusion through Mercado Pago, the company's digital payments and financial services arm. This initiative has become increasingly central to the value proposition, connecting merchants and consumers with accessible credit and payment solutions.
The company noted that marketplace dynamics remain constructive, with seller base expansion and improved take rates contributing to top-line growth. Management also discussed operational efficiency initiatives that have helped optimize fulfillment costs, though they acknowledged ongoing investments in technology and infrastructure remain significant.

Forward Guidance
Looking ahead, MercadoLibre indicated it would continue prioritizing long-term growth over short-term margin expansion. The company maintains its focus on market penetration strategies in existing territories while exploring opportunities to deepen its service offerings.
Management suggested that logistics investments would remain elevated as the company works to extend next-day delivery capabilities to additional markets. This infrastructure buildout represents a key competitive differentiator in the region.
The company also pointed to expanding opportunities in its fintech segment, with potential for growth in credit penetration and new financial product development. MercadoLibre's data advantage from transaction history supports prudent underwriting while enabling tailored financial solutions for merchants and consumers.
